fine art insurance coverage is a specialized insurance policy designed to protect valuable artwork from various risks. Whether you are a seasoned collector, an art dealer, or a gallery owner, having the right insurance coverage for your art collection is essential to safeguard your investment. This type of insurance typically covers a wide range of scenarios, including theft, fire, water damage, accidental damage, transit damage, and vandalism.

When it comes to selecting a fine art insurance policy, there are several factors to consider. The first step is to assess the value of your art collection accurately. This involves working with a professional appraiser who can determine the current market value of each piece in your collection. Having an up-to-date appraisal is crucial for ensuring that you have adequate coverage in place and that you are not underinsured.
Once you have determined the value of your art collection, the next step is to choose a reputable insurance provider that specializes in fine art insurance. It is essential to work with an insurance company that has experience in insuring valuable artworks and understands the unique risks associated with owning fine art. Look for providers that offer customized policies tailored to your specific needs and budget.
Another important consideration when selecting a fine art insurance policy is to review the coverage limits and exclusions carefully. Make sure that the policy provides sufficient coverage for all the risks that your artwork may face, including theft, damage, and loss. Pay close attention to any exclusions that could potentially leave you vulnerable in the event of a claim. It is also advisable to inquire about additional coverage options, such as transit insurance for artworks that are frequently transported or loaned out for exhibitions.
In addition to selecting the right insurance policy, it is essential to take proactive measures to protect your art collection and minimize the risk of damage or loss. This includes investing in high-quality security systems, such as alarm systems, surveillance cameras, and secure display cases. It is also advisable to keep detailed records of all your artworks, including photographs, appraisals, and purchase receipts. This documentation can be invaluable in the event of a claim and can help expedite the claims process.
